|  Scholarships  
 2012 Foundation Scholarship Recipients 
 
 |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| 
 Markita Hill (12) 
			
			 Markita, who received the Foundation's Jennie Denison Bayne Memorial Scholarship that is awarded to graduates planning to study in the health field, plans to attend Spelman College in the Fall to study biology and ultimately become a dentist and forensic odontologist. Markita's Surrattsville achievements include National Honor Society, JROTC Cadet of the Year, Principal's Honor Roll, multiple JROTC ribbons and awards, Marching Band, Peer Mediator, Special Olympics, and Maryland Girls' State. Outside of school, she was active in Dove's Ministry.
